It's been 7 months since I began writing for Odyssey as a part of the UCF Community. It was a fun ride, but due to my increasing workload and extracurriculars, it's best for me to bid adieu. However, I want to recount on the topics I talked about and rank my own work. From racial issues to pop music, I think I cast a good spectrum of topics I covered while writing for Odyssey.

3. "The 4 Types Of People, From Stalkers To SJW'S, You'll Find On Twitter"

c1.staticflickr.com

For those who don't know, or couldn't tell, Twitter is one of my favorite social media sites (follow me here). So I decided, why not write about one of my favorite social media sites? It took me a while to figure out just how to write about Twitter. It wasn't until I saw a tweet talking about the 'cults' of different states. It hit me, there are different communities on Twitter that operate very differently. 'Stan Twitter' for example are harsh and can be some of the meanest people on the internet. While 'Black Twitter' is one of the funniest and light-hearted communities on Twitter. If you wanna go more in-depth on the 'cults of Twitter' I suggest you give this article a read here.
